Change is stressful. When routines are disrupted and expectations shift, it’s natural for leaders to feel a loss of control. This can trigger behaviors such as:
Micromanagement: Trying to control every detail to minimise risk.
Blame-shifting: Avoiding accountability when things get tough.
Communication breakdowns: Withholding information or failing to listen.
Resistance to feedback: Ignoring valuable input from the team.
These habits erode trust, reduce engagement, and make change harder for everyone.

What is Insights Discovery?
Insights Discovery is a powerful psychometric tool based on Carl Jung’s psychology. It uses a simple four-colour model, Fiery Red, Sunshine Yellow, Earth Green, and Cool Blue, to help leaders and teams understand their unique personalities, communication styles, and behavioural preferences.

Start with Self-Reflection: Use Insights Discovery to gain a clear picture of your leadership style. Are you prone to micromanage under stress? Do you avoid tough conversations? Awareness is the first step to change.
Understand Your Team: Map out your team’s Insights Discovery profiles. Recognise who needs detailed information (Cool Blue), who thrives on encouragement (Sunshine Yellow), who values harmony (Earth Green), and who wants quick results (Fiery Red).
Adapt Your Approach: Communicate change initiatives in ways that resonate with each personality type. Offer clarity to some, reassurance to others, and opportunities for involvement to all.
Foster Open Dialogue: Create safe spaces for feedback and questions. Use the common language of Insights Discovery to navigate difficult conversations and resolve conflicts constructively.
Model Positive Behaviors: Demonstrate transparency, empathy, and accountability. When leaders model these traits, teams are more likely to mirror them, especially during times of change.
